James Lombardi ran for election to the Lexington City Council to represent District 9 in Kentucky. He lost in the general election on November 8, 2022.

General election

General election for Lexington City Council District 9

Incumbent Whitney Elliott Baxter defeated James Lombardi in the general election for Lexington City Council District 9 on November 8, 2022.

Nonpartisan primary election

The primary election was canceled. Incumbent Whitney Elliott Baxter and James Lombardi advanced from the primary for Lexington City Council District 9.
